Festus has an obesity rate of 41.4%, which is 5.3pp above the national average. The depression rate is 24.9%, 1.4pp above the national average. About 8.8% of adults lack health insurance. 78.2% of residents had an annual checkup in the past year. There are 5 hospitals nearby. 5 offer emergency services. The average CMS quality rating is 3.3 out of 5.
